Gérer le Mode Paysage dans votre Application Android

Apprenez à gérer le mode paysage dans une application Android en créant des layouts spécifiques et en ajustant les fichiers de ressources nécessaires.

Détails de la leçon

Description de la leçon

Dans cette leçon, nous allons nous concentrer sur la gestion du mode paysage (landscape) dans une application Android. Nous commencerons par créer des dossiers drawable spécifiques pour accueillir les différents médias adaptés aux diverses résolutions d'écran. Ensuite, nous modifierons le manifeste pour permettre la réorientation de l'écran, ce qui nécessitera des ajustements dans l'activité principale, notamment le positionnement des logos.

Nous continuerons avec la création d'un layout de jeu pour le mode paysage. Cela implique des réorganisations dans le MainActivity pour s'assurer que les éléments tels que les pictogrammes et les boutons d'action soient correctement positionnés sur l'écran.

Enfin, nous testerons l'application pour vérifier que les images ne sont pas étirées et que chaque orientation affiche la bonne ressource visuelle. Cet apprentissage est essentiel pour garantir une expérience utilisateur fluide et agréable, quelle que soit l'orientation de l'appareil.

Objectifs de cette leçon

L'objectif de cette vidéo est de vous apprendre à:

  • Créer et organiser des dossiers drawable spécifiques au mode paysage.
  • Déverrouiller le mode portrait dans le manifeste de l'application.
  • Adapter les layouts existants pour qu'ils fonctionnent en mode paysage.
  • Tester les ajustements pour garantir une expérience utilisateur optimale.

Prérequis pour cette leçon

Pour suivre cette vidéo, vous devez avoir des connaissances de base en développement Android, notamment en création de layouts XML et en manipulation du fichier AndroidManifest.xml.

Métiers concernés

Ce sujet est pertinent pour les développeurs d'applications mobiles, en particulier ceux spécialisés en développement Android. Les compétences acquises peuvent être appliquées dans divers métiers tels que développeur mobile, ingénieur logiciel et chef de projet technique.

Alternatives et ressources

Pour gérer les orientations d'écran, vous pouvez également explorer l'utilisation de ConstraintLayout et FrameLayout pour créer des interfaces utilisateur flexibles qui s'adaptent à différentes orientations et tailles d'écran.

Questions & Réponses

Les dossiers drawable spécifiques pour le mode paysage permettent de gérer différentes résolutions d'écran et garantir que les images et autres ressources s'affichent correctement sans distorsion.
Il est nécessaire de déverrouiller le mode portrait dans le fichier AndroidManifest.xml pour permettre à l'application de s'adapter aux différentes orientations d'écran.
Les principales étapes incluent la modification de l'orientation de l'appareil, la vérification de l'affichage correct des images et des logos, et la confirmation que les ressources appropriées sont utilisées en fonction de l'orientation.